Pete Twidle

Pete Twidle is the founder of Change Craft. He works with organisations to improve how people adopt new ways of working.

His focus is Precision AI Prompting for Change and Transformation. He shows teams how to use AI in practical, everyday tasks to save time and improve clarity.

Pete has led large-scale change programmes across public and private sector organisations. His training is direct, hands-on, and built around real work

Ryan Kerrisk

Electrical Training Specialist | Registered Electrical Inspector

Specialising in Solar Inspections and Renewables. Ryan is an EWRB Registered Electrical Inspector with over 10 years experience working individually and managing teams in installation, engineering, sales, and project management.

Specialist areas include:  Renewables and solar, Clean Energy Council Qualified, team leadership, project management and consulting, electrical design and engineering, quoting, tendering and sales, customer service and customer relationship management, technical advice.

Stephen Thomson

Electrical Training Specialist | Registered Electrical Inspector

Experienced and licensed Electrical Inspector and Electrician with a strong background in maintenance and project management across diverse commercial, medical, and industrial sectors, including petrochemical, manufacturing (plastics, steel, animal feed, food), hospitals (public and private), surgeries, and forestry.

Proven expertise in hazardous areas, medical, quality assurance, safety compliance, and team supervision in both New Zealand and Australia. Adept at optimising plant operations, leading projects, and ensuring adherence to industry standards.

 

Storm Holgate

Electrical Training Specialist | Registered Electrical Inspector

Storm is a 4th generation electrical worker with 10 years qualified experience across domestic, commercial, industrial, and marine electrical environments. Storm has been working in the electrical industry with his family for over 20 years, having been a side hand to electricians from the age of 10.

Throughout Storm’s career, mentoring apprentices, supervising teams, and leading projects have been key responsibilities.

Storm also has a strong practical background in off-grid solar installations, generator service and installation, supermarket and apartment block servicing, large-scale commercial construction projects and a multitude of other electrical installations.

With deep knowledge of New Zealand electrical regulations, codes, and safety standards, Storm maintains a strong focus on compliance. Storm currently works as the Technical Manager for Master Electricians NZ.
